Как убрать ссылку из Excel: все способы от ручного удаления до автоматического

Работа с гиперссылками в Microsoft Excel часто становится головной болью: они мешают форматированию, автоматически открывают браузер при случайном клике, а иногда и вовсе появляются там, где их никто не просил. Например, при копировании данных из веб-страниц или других документов Excel автоматически преобразует URL-адреса и email-адреса в кликабельные ссылки, что не всегда удобно. Эта статья поможет разобраться, как удалить ненужные гиперссылки быстро и без последствий — от элементарного клика правой кнопкой до продвинутых методов с использованием макросов.

Мы рассмотрим не только стандартные способы удаления ссылок из отдельных ячеек, но и массовые операции для целых диапазонов, листов или даже книг. Особое внимание уделим скрытым гиперссылкам, которые не видны в интерфейсе, но продолжают влиять на поведение файла — их часто упускают из виду. А для тех, кто работает с большими объемами данных, приведём оптимальные решения с использованием VBA и Power Query.

1. Удаление гиперссылки из одной ячейки: 3 быстрых метода

Если вам нужно убрать ссылку из конкретной ячейки, не затрагивая соседние данные, воспользуйтесь одним из этих способов. Они подходят для Excel 2010–2026 и Excel Online, но в веб-версии функционал может быть ограничен.

Самый очевидный путь — кликнуть правой кнопкой мыши по ячейке со ссылкой и выбрать Удалить гиперссылку в контекстном меню. Однако этот метод работает только если ссылка была добавлена вручную через Вставка → Гиперссылка. Если же Excel автоматически распознал текст как URL (например, https://example.com), то в меню появится пункт Удалить гиперссылку, но сам текст останется.

  • 🖱️ Способ 1: Контекстное меню

    Кликните правой кнопкой по ячейке → Удалить гиперссылку. Подходит для ручных ссылок.

  • ⌨️ Способ 2: Горячие клавиши

    Выделите ячейку и нажмите Ctrl + 1 (откроется окно формата) → перейдите на вкладку Защита → снимите галочку Гиперссылка.

  • 📝 Способ 3: Редактирование текста

    Дважды кликните по ячейке, чтобы перейти в режим редактирования, затем удалите часть текста с http:// или www.Excel автоматически уберёт форматирование ссылки.

⚠️ Внимание: Если после удаления ссылки текст в ячейке стал синим и подчёркнутым, это означает, что сохранён стиль форматирования. Чтобы вернуть стандартный вид, выделите ячейку и нажмите Ctrl + \ (сброс формата).
📊 Как часто вам приходится удалять гиперссылки в Excel?
Постоянно, это часть моей работы
Иногда, при копировании данных из интернета
Рядом, только если они мешают
Никогда не сталкивался с этой проблемой

2. Массовое удаление ссылок из диапазона ячеек

Когда гиперссылок много — например, в столбце с сотнями email-адресов или URL — удалять их по одной нерационально. В таких случаях поможет инструмент Найти и заменить или специальная надстройка Power Query (доступна в Excel 2016 и новее).

Самый универсальный метод — использование функции ГИПЕРССЫЛКА в комбинации с Значение. Создайте вспомогательный столбец рядом с данными и введите формулу:

=ЗНАЧЕН(ПОДСТАВИТЬ(A1;"=";""))

Эта формула удаляет символ =, который Excel добавляет перед гиперссылками при их создании через функцию ГИПЕРССЫЛКА. После применения формулы скопируйте результаты и вставьте их поверх оригинальных данных через Специальная вставка → Значения.

Метод Подходит для Ограничения
Найти и заменить (Ctrl + H) Автоматически созданные ссылки (URL, email) Не удаляет ручные гиперссылки, добавленные через Вставка → Гиперссылка
Формула =ЗНАЧЕН(ПОДСТАВИТЬ(...)) Ссылки, созданные функцией ГИПЕРССЫЛКА Требует вспомогательного столбца
Power Query (запрос Заменить значения) Большие наборы данных (тысячи строк) Необходимы базовые знания Power Query

Создать резервную копию файла|Проверить, какие ссылки ручные, а какие автоматические|Определить, нужно ли сохранять текст ссылки или только убирать кликабельность|Выбрать метод в зависимости от объёма данных-->

3. Как убрать все гиперссылки на листе или в книге

Если файл заполнен ссылками на всех листах, ручное удаление займёт часы. К счастью, в Excel есть встроенные инструменты для массовой очистки. Самый простой способ — использовать макрос, но для тех, кто не знаком с VBA, подойдёт и стандартный функционал.

Чтобы удалить все гиперссылки на активном листе:

  1. Нажмите Ctrl + A, чтобы выделить все ячейки (или Ctrl + Shift + Пробел для выделения всего листа).
  2. Кликните правой кнопкой и выберите Удалить гиперссылки (если пункт неактивен, значит, на листе нет ручных ссылок).
  3. Для автоматических ссылок (URL в тексте) используйте Найти и заменить (Ctrl + H), где в поле Найти введите http:// или https://, а поле Заменить на оставьте пустым.

Для удаления ссылок во всей книге придётся воспользоваться VBA. Откройте редактор макросов (Alt + F11), вставьте следующий код и запустите его:

Sub DeleteAllHyperlinks()

Dim ws As Worksheet

For Each ws In ActiveWorkbook.Worksheets

ws.Hyperlinks.Delete

Next ws

End Sub

⚠️ Внимание: Макрос удаляет все гиперссылки без возможности отмены (даже через Ctrl + Z). Перед запуском сохраните файл и проверьте, нет ли среди ссылок важных (например, ссылок на другие листы или файлы).

4. Скрытые гиперссылки: как найти и удалить

Иногда гиперссылки в Excel не видны невооружённым глазом, но продолжают влиять на работу файла. Они могут:

  • 🔗 Мешать сортировке данных (ячейки со ссылками сортируются отдельно).
  • 🖲️ Вызывать случайные клики при наведении курсора.
  • 📊 Увеличивать размер файла без видимой причины.

Чтобы обнаружить такие ссылки, воспользуйтесь одним из методов:

  1. Проверка через Условное форматирование:

    Выделите диапазон → Главная → Условное форматирование → Создать правило → Использовать формулу → введите =ГИПЕРССЫЛКА(A1)<>"" → задайте формат (например, красный фон). Все ячейки со ссылками будут подсвечены.

  2. Поиск через Найти и выделить:

    Нажмите Ctrl + FПараметры → Формат → Гиперссылка. Excel покажет все ячейки с гиперссылками, даже если они не отображаются как текст.

После обнаружения удалите ссылки любым из методов, описанных выше. Если ссылки добавлены через функцию ГИПЕРССЫЛКА, их можно найти по формуле: выделите диапазон → Найти и выделить → Перейти к специальным → Формулы.

Почему Excel автоматически создаёт гиперссылки?

По умолчанию в Excel включена функция Автозамена гиперссылок, которая распознаёт URL-адреса, email-адреса и сетевые пути (например, \\server\folder) и преобразует их в кликабельные ссылки. Это можно отключить:

  1. Перейдите в Файл → Параметры → Правописание → Параметры автозамены.
  2. На вкладке Автоформат при вводе снимите галочку Заменять при вводе: адреса Интернета и сетевые пути гиперссылками.

После этого новые данные не будут автоматически превращаться в ссылки, но старые останутся нетронутыми.

5. Удаление ссылок без потери форматирования

Одна из самых распространённых проблем при удалении гиперссылок — потеря форматирования ячеек. Например, если текст ссылки был выделен жирным или имел специфический цвет, после удаления ссылки эти настройки могут сброситься. Чтобы этого избежать, действуйте по алгоритму:

  1. Выделите ячейки со ссылками.
  2. Скопируйте их (Ctrl + C).
  3. Вставьте данные в Блокнот (или любой другой текстовый редактор), затем скопируйте обратно в Excel. Это удалит все гиперссылки, но сохранит текст.
  4. Примените оригинальное форматирование вручную или через Формат по образцу (Ctrl + Shift + C/Ctrl + Shift + V).

Альтернативный способ — использовать VBA-макрос, который сохраняет форматирование:

Sub RemoveHyperlinksKeepFormat()

Dim cell As Range

For Each cell In Selection

If cell.Hyperlinks.Count > 0 Then

cell.Hyperlinks.Delete

' Сохраняем цвет и шрифт

cell.Font.Color = cell.Font.Color

cell.Font.Bold = cell.Font.Bold

End If

Next cell

End Sub

Этот макрос проходит по всем выделенным ячейкам, удаляет гиперссылки, но оставляет цвет текста и начертание шрифта. Для запуска выделите диапазон и выполните макрос через Alt + F8.

6. Автоматизация: как предотвратить появление ссылок в будущем

Чтобы не тратить время на удаление гиперссылок каждый раз при импорте данных, настройте Excel заранее. Вот несколько профилактических мер:

  • ⚙️ Отключите автоформатирование:

    Как описано в спойлере выше, отключите опцию Заменять при вводе: адреса Интернета... в параметрах автозамены.

  • 📥 Используйте Power Query для импорта:

    При импорте данных из веб-страниц или CSV-файлов Power Query позволяет очищать гиперссылки на этапе загрузки. Добавьте шаг Заменить значения для столбцов с URL.

  • 📑 Вставляйте данные как текст:

    При копировании из браузера используйте Специальная вставка → Текст (Alt + E → S → T в старых версиях). Это предотвратит создание ссылок.

Если вы часто работаете с данными, содержащими URL, создайте шаблон Excel-файла с отключённым автоформатированием и сохранёнными настройками Power Query. Это сэкономит время при повторяющихся задачах.

7. Частые ошибки и как их избежать

При работе с гиперссылками пользователи часто сталкиваются с типичными проблемами, которые ведут к потере данных или некорректной работе файла. Вот наиболее распространённые из них:

Ошибка Причина Решение
После удаления ссылок текст стал формулой (например, =ГИПЕРССЫЛКА(...)) Ссылки были созданы через функцию ГИПЕРССЫЛКА, а не вручную Используйте =ЗНАЧЕН(A1), чтобы преобразовать формулу в текст
Удалены не все ссылки на листе Невидимые ссылки в скрытых строках/столбцах или на других листах Проверьте весь файл через Найти и выделить → Гиперссылка
Файл стал медленно работать после удаления ссылок Остались "мертвые" ссылки (удалённые, но не очищенные из памяти) Сохраните файл в формате .xlsx (если был .xlsm), затем откройте заново

Ещё одна распространённая проблема — ссылки, ведущие на несуществующие файлы. Если вы удалили гиперссылку, но при открытии файла Excel всё равно выдаёт ошибку о повреждённых ссылках, это означает, что где-то в книге остались внешние ссылки (например, на другие файлы или веб-страницы). Чтобы их найти:

  1. Перейдите в Данные → Запросы и соединения → Изменить связиExcel 2016 и новее).
  2. Проверьте список внешних ссылок и удалите ненужные.

FAQ: Ответы на частые вопросы

Можно ли удалить гиперссылки в Excel Online?

Да, но функционал ограничен. В Excel Online можно удалить гиперссылки из отдельных ячеек через контекстное меню, но массовые операции (например, удаление всех ссылок на листе) недоступны. Для этого потребуется открыть файл в десктопной версии.

Почему после удаления ссылок текст остаётся синим и подчёркнутым?

Это означает, что сохранён стиль форматирования гиперссылки. Чтобы убрать его, выделите ячейки и нажмите Ctrl + \ (сброс формата) или вручную измените цвет и подчёркивание в окне формата ячеек (Ctrl + 1).

Как удалить гиперссылки в защищённом листе?

Если лист защищён, сначала снимите защиту: Рецензирование → Снять защиту листа (потребуется пароль, если он был установлен). После удаления ссылок защиту можно вернуть.

Можно ли вернуть удалённые гиперссылки?

Если вы не сохраняли файл после удаления, воспользуйтесь функцией отмены (Ctrl + Z). В противном случае придётся восстанавливать данные из резервной копии или создавать ссылки заново. Excel не ведёт журнал изменений для гиперссылок.

Почему при копировании из Excel в Word гиперссылки остаются?

При вставке в Word гиперссылки сохраняются, если используется стандартная вставка (Ctrl + V). Чтобы этого избежать, вставляйте данные через Специальная вставка → Неформатированный текст.